есть вложенность
This commit is contained in:
@@ -66,7 +66,7 @@
|
|||||||
for (var номер = 0; номер < пройти; ++номер)
|
for (var номер = 0; номер < пройти; ++номер)
|
||||||
{
|
{
|
||||||
var внутреннийКлюч = путь[номер];
|
var внутреннийКлюч = путь[номер];
|
||||||
console.debug("проход номер/внутреннийКлюч", номер, внутреннийКлюч);
|
console.debug("проход номер/внутреннийКлюч/путь", номер, внутреннийКлюч, путь);
|
||||||
var внутреннийСловарь = вложенность[внутреннийКлюч];
|
var внутреннийСловарь = вложенность[внутреннийКлюч];
|
||||||
if (!внутреннийСловарь)
|
if (!внутреннийСловарь)
|
||||||
{
|
{
|
||||||
@@ -74,6 +74,11 @@ console.debug("проход номер/внутреннийКлюч", номер
|
|||||||
внутреннийСловарь = вложенность[внутреннийКлюч];
|
внутреннийСловарь = вложенность[внутреннийКлюч];
|
||||||
вложенность = внутреннийСловарь;
|
вложенность = внутреннийСловарь;
|
||||||
}
|
}
|
||||||
|
// Прошли.
|
||||||
|
if (пройти - номер == 1)
|
||||||
|
{
|
||||||
|
внутреннийСловарь[путь[пройти]] = значение;
|
||||||
|
}
|
||||||
|
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|||||||
@@ -24,6 +24,11 @@
|
|||||||
collisionFilter: {
|
collisionFilter: {
|
||||||
mask: 0x0008,
|
mask: 0x0008,
|
||||||
},
|
},
|
||||||
|
внутри: {
|
||||||
|
ещё: {
|
||||||
|
key: "value",
|
||||||
|
},
|
||||||
|
},
|
||||||
},
|
},
|
||||||
},
|
},
|
||||||
полСлева: {
|
полСлева: {
|
||||||
|
|||||||
Reference in New Issue
Block a user